WebOct 7, 2024 · FTIR analysis of activated charcoal shows characteristic broad peak in 1500–1600 cm −1, and 1100–1300 cm −1 range corresponds to C=O, and C–O stretching, and O–H bending, respectively, thereby indicating the surface activation of carbon present in activated charcoal [25, 26, 36, 37]. WebThis research studies the characterization of activated carbon from tamarind seed with KOH activation. The effects of 0.5 : 1-1.5 : 1 KOH : tamarind seed charcoal ratios and 500-700°C activation temperatures were studied.
